Preston Chaney 09-27-2015 05:31 PM

Hi,
How does one restore Damascus Barrels? I apologize if this has been discussed before but a cursory scan of the posts didn't show up any instructions.
Regards
Preston Chaney

Rick Losey 09-27-2015 06:57 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Preston Chaney (Post 178178)
Hi,
How does one restore Damascus Barrels? I apologize if this has been discussed before but a cursory scan of the posts didn't show up any instructions.
Regards
Preston Chaney

i do not believe the process has been discussed here- just the examples done by the pros

the best information source is Dr Gaddy's DGJ articles
i think they are in
Double Gun Journal Vol 8, Issues 2 and 3, 1997 and Vol 14, Issue 1, 2003
